Product Overview

Category

The AD5542AARUZ belongs to the category of digital-to-analog converters (DACs).

Use

It is primarily used for converting digital signals into analog voltages.

Characteristics

  • High precision and accuracy
  • Fast settling time
  • Low power consumption
  • Wide operating voltage range

Package

The AD5542AARUZ comes in a small outline integrated circuit (SOIC) package.

Essence

The essence of the AD5542AARUZ is its ability to convert digital data into precise analog voltages with high resolution.

Packaging/Quantity

The AD5542AARUZ is typically packaged in reels and is available in quantities of 2500 units per reel.

Specifications

  • Resolution: 16 bits
  • Output Voltage Range: 0V to Vref
  • Reference Voltage Range: 2.5V to 5.5V
  • Supply Voltage Range: 2.7V to 5.5V
  • Operating Temperature Range: -40°C to +105°C
  • Power Consumption: 1.8mW (typical)

Working Principles

The AD5542AARUZ operates by accepting digital input data and converting it into an analog voltage output. It utilizes a 16-bit resolution to provide high precision and accuracy in the conversion process. The chip's internal circuitry ensures fast settling time, allowing for rapid and stable voltage outputs. The AD5542AARUZ requires a reference voltage input to establish the desired output voltage range.

Detailed Application Field Plans

The AD5542AARUZ finds applications in various fields, including:

  1. Industrial automation: Used in control systems to convert digital signals into analog voltages for precise control of industrial processes.
  2. Test and measurement equipment: Integrated into instruments such as oscilloscopes and signal generators to generate accurate analog waveforms.
  3. Audio equipment: Employed in audio devices like digital-to-analog converters for high-fidelity sound reproduction.
  4. Communication systems: Utilized in base stations and transceivers to convert digital signals into analog voltages for modulation and demodulation processes.
